How we estimate the "escalation tax"

The escalation tax includes three components: (1) labor time from agents and engineers, (2) SLA credits/penalties, and (3) revenue at risk from customer churn due to slower or fragmented resolutions.

  • Labor cost = (agent mins + engineer mins)/60 × respective hourly rates × # of escalations.
  • SLA credits = per-escalation credits × # of escalations.
  • Revenue at risk = affected accounts × ARR × incremental churn probability (monthly).
